Scenic routes are appealing to travelers because they offer breathtaking views of natural landscapes, cultural sites, and historic landmarks. These routes provide a unique opportunity for travelers to immerse themselves in the beauty of their surroundings while enjoying a leisurely drive or hike.

Some examples of famous scenic routes around the world include:

1. Pacific Coast Highway, California, USA

The Pacific Coast Highway offers stunning views of the Pacific Ocean, rugged cliffs, and picturesque seaside towns. Travelers can enjoy beautiful sunsets and spot wildlife such as whales and dolphins along this iconic route.

2. Great Ocean Road, Australia

The Great Ocean Road winds along the southeastern coast of Australia, showcasing the famous Twelve Apostles rock formations, lush rainforests, and pristine beaches. Travelers can explore charming coastal towns and experience the diverse wildlife of the region.

3. Ring Road, Iceland

The Ring Road in Iceland is a circular route that circumnavigates the entire island, offering dramatic landscapes including glaciers, waterfalls, volcanoes, and geothermal hot springs. Travelers can witness the Northern Lights during the winter months and enjoy the midnight sun in summer.

Scenic routes contribute significantly to tourism and local economies by attracting visitors from around the world. These routes often pass through rural areas, providing opportunities for small businesses such as cafes, gift shops, and accommodations to thrive. Additionally, scenic routes create jobs in tourism-related industries and help preserve natural and cultural heritage sites for future generations to enjoy.

When exploring scenic routes with historic landmarks, travelers have the opportunity to engage in interactive experiences that bring history to life. These experiences not only educate visitors but also create memorable moments during their journey.

Interactive Guided Tours

Many historic landmarks along scenic routes offer interactive guided tours led by knowledgeable experts. Visitors can learn interesting facts, stories, and even participate in hands-on activities that provide a deeper understanding of the site’s significance.

Augmented Reality Experiences

Some historic landmarks have embraced technology by incorporating augmented reality features into the visitor experience. Through AR apps on smartphones or provided devices, travelers can see virtual reconstructions, historical images, and interactive elements overlaid on the physical site, enhancing their understanding and engagement.

Interactive Exhibits and Workshops

At certain historic sites, interactive exhibits and workshops are available to visitors, allowing them to interact with historical artifacts, try traditional crafts, or participate in reenactments. These hands-on activities offer a unique way to connect with the past and gain a more immersive experience.

Local culture and heritage play a significant role in the preservation and showcasing of historic landmarks along scenic routes. These landmarks often serve as a reflection of the traditions, values, and practices of the communities that have inhabited the area for generations.Visitors to historic landmarks along scenic routes have a direct impact on the local communities. They bring economic opportunities through tourism, which can support local businesses and help in the conservation efforts of these landmarks.

However, an influx of tourists can also lead to challenges such as overcrowding, increased waste, and potential damage to the sites if not managed sustainably.Initiatives promoting sustainable tourism while celebrating local culture along scenic routes are crucial for maintaining the balance between preservation and visitor experience. These initiatives may include community-led tourism projects, educational programs on the history and significance of the landmarks, and responsible travel practices that respect the local environment and traditions.

Initiatives for Sustainable Tourism

  • Implementing carrying capacity limits to manage visitor numbers and reduce environmental impact.
  • Engaging local communities in tourism planning and decision-making processes to ensure their cultural heritage is respected.
  • Offering authentic cultural experiences, such as traditional music performances or craft demonstrations, to visitors.
  • Collaborating with local schools and organizations to promote awareness of the importance of preserving local heritage.
